## Formula sandbox tuning

User-supplied formulas in Gridmoor execute inside a restricted interpreter with hard ceilings on time, memory, and call depth. Reviewers should confirm any change to these ceilings is justified in the PR description, since raising them widens the abuse surface. Defaults were chosen from production traces. The current limits are as follows.

limits module of tafog-fawip:
WEIGHTS = {
    "julix": 57,
    "lamys": 992,
    "kasvan": 209,
    "quenok": 750,
    "alddor": 259,
    "oliath": 1009,
    "wenix": 815,
}

Subject: Handover — GiveNote receipt mailer release duties

Hi team, I'm handing release management for the GiveNote donation-receipt mailer over to Priya starting Monday. Current state: v5.2 is in staging, templates for the year-end receipt batch are frozen, and the send queue is paused pending sign-off. Support should route any bounced-receipt complaints to the mailer channel as usual. Signed builds go through the Ardmore pipeline only. For verification during the transition, the active deploy key is below.

rollout seal: bky9_PeXH1fTLY

- [ ] Catch the shuttle bus from Harlow Quay to the Brindlemoor campus. Heads up: the shuttle gate by Building K is badge-controlled, and your permanent pass won't be live until day two. Don't panic — the driver knows new starters come through on Mondays. Just hop off, walk to the small gate reader on the left, and punch in the temporary access code below.

door code, bagef-yafop: bdg-ZFZML-07646

Ticket: Config drift in tax-rate lookup cache

The Fennwick tax-rate cache behaves differently in staging vs prod. Staging was hand-edited last quarter to extend TTLs during the Ostermere rate freeze and never reverted. Result: stale rates served up to 6h in staging, masking a refresh bug that only surfaced in prod. Action: revert staging to the canonical values, add a drift check to the deploy pipeline, and treat manual edits as incidents. For reference, the canonical settings are listed below.

config for hahag-bahaf:
[briael]
host = briael.norvaworks.internal
user = briael_svc
database = briael_prod